Output c59a19313b91f836cf7389e7903cdef1af545ddf4b26295e5a460989113edab6:0

value
56908
script pubkey
OP_0 OP_PUSHBYTES_20 c8d4b2cc68d4a3ff56e64389136dfa574b8f39b9
address
bc1qer2t9nrg6j3l74hxgwy3xm062a9c7wdeqx0v9t
transaction
c59a19313b91f836cf7389e7903cdef1af545ddf4b26295e5a460989113edab6
confirmations
134921
spent
true